Under direction of the MRI Supervisor and according to established protocols and procedures and the directions of a Radiologist, operates MRI scanner to obtain filmed images for use by physicians in diagnoses and treatment of pathologies. Provides care to neonate, pediatric, adult and geriatric patients.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ES:

1. Must have completed two years of post high school training in an approved school of radiologic technology.

2. Must have interpersonal skills sufficient to interact effectively with patients who may be under physical and/or emotional stress.

3. Must have analytical abilities necessary to acquire and effectively utilize knowledge of MRI techniques and methods and knowledge of cross sectional anatomy.

4. Previous MRI experience preferred.

5. Work requires three months on-the-job training to acquire necessary familiarity with MRI procedures, techniques and methods.

6. Registration, Certification or Licensure Requirement: ARRT registered. Current BLS Certification. MRI registry preferred.

Principal Duties and Responsibilities Performance

1. Interviews patient to determine patient eligibility for MRI exam (example: pacemaker, vascular clips, foreign bodies, hearing aid). Fills out patient eligibility sheet and gets patient signature for consent before starting exam.

2. Examines patient's charts to be aware of suspected pathologies and appropriate clinical history while conducting exam. Takes standard radiographs as necessary for preliminary exam.

3. Starts IVs and Administers injections of contrast media for examinations following established sterile techniques and methods.

4. Operates scanner's computerized controls and enters commands necessary to visualize and manipulate screen images. Operates various peripheral equipment such as optical disc drive.

5. Manipulates MRI image through computerized controls to obtain best possible images.

6. Operates Laser Imager to reproduce appropriate screen images on film. Ensures films are of acceptable diagnostic quality and completeness.

7. Maintains required files and records and prepares periodic statistical reports, such as number and types of exams performed for supervisor's review.

8. Notifies appropriate personnel of equipment malfunctions and repairs as needed. Ensures necessary maintenance and repairs are completed in an efficient and timely manner.

9. Schedules MRI examinations in order to ensure smooth flow and optimal utilization of equipment.

10. Requisitions, stores and inventories approved supplies in assigned area, such as linen, syringes, needles, contrast media and so forth.

11. Instructs and demonstrates MRI equipment operation, filming and other technical aspects for radiology students and Radiology or Medical Center personnel.

12. Assists physicians doing invasive sterile technique procedures.

13. Adheres to the standards and policies of the Corporate Responsibility Program, including the duty to comply with applicable laws and regulations, and reporting to designated Manager (or employer hotline) any suspected unethical, fraudulent, or unlawful acts or practices.

14. Embraces Standards of Excellence in order to provide and promote excellent customer service for both internal and external customers. Holds self and others accountable for behaviors that promote service excellence.

15. Demonstrates behaviors consistent with Mission and Core Values (Compassion, Excellence, Human Dignity, Justice, Sacredness of Life, Service) of Mercy Health Partners.

16. Demonstrates knowledge and skills necessary to provide care appropriate to the age of the patient served
